Home
last modified time | relevance | path

Searched refs:hop_pte_addr (Results 1 - 5 of 5) sorted by relevance

/kernel/linux/linux-6.6/drivers/accel/habanalabs/common/mmu/
H A Dmmu_v1.c486 u64 hop_addr[MMU_V1_MAX_HOPS] = {0}, hop_pte_addr[MMU_V1_MAX_HOPS] = {0}, curr_pte = 0; in hl_mmu_v1_unmap() local
505 hop_pte_addr[hop_idx] = in hl_mmu_v1_unmap()
508 curr_pte = *(u64 *) (uintptr_t) hop_pte_addr[hop_idx]; in hl_mmu_v1_unmap()
524 hop_pte_addr[hop_idx] = in hl_mmu_v1_unmap()
526 curr_pte = *(u64 *) (uintptr_t) hop_pte_addr[hop_idx]; in hl_mmu_v1_unmap()
549 write_final_pte(ctx, hop_pte_addr[hop_idx], default_pte); in hl_mmu_v1_unmap()
556 clear_pte(ctx, hop_pte_addr[MMU_HOP4]); in hl_mmu_v1_unmap()
558 clear_pte(ctx, hop_pte_addr[MMU_HOP3]); in hl_mmu_v1_unmap()
567 clear_pte(ctx, hop_pte_addr[hop_idx]); in hl_mmu_v1_unmap()
590 u64 hop_addr[MMU_V1_MAX_HOPS] = {0}, hop_pte_addr[MMU_V1_MAX_HOP in hl_mmu_v1_map() local
[all...]
H A Dmmu.c1181 hops->hop_info[i].hop_pte_addr = in hl_mmu_hr_get_tlb_info()
1187 hops->hop_info[i].hop_pte_addr, in hl_mmu_hr_get_tlb_info()
/kernel/linux/linux-5.10/drivers/misc/habanalabs/common/
H A Ddebugfs.c621 u64 hop_addr, hop_pte_addr, hop_pte; in device_va_to_pa() local
642 hop_pte_addr = get_hop0_pte_addr(ctx, mmu_prop, hop_addr, virt_addr); in device_va_to_pa()
643 hop_pte = hdev->asic_funcs->read_pte(hdev, hop_pte_addr); in device_va_to_pa()
649 hop_pte_addr = get_hop1_pte_addr(ctx, mmu_prop, hop_addr, virt_addr); in device_va_to_pa()
650 hop_pte = hdev->asic_funcs->read_pte(hdev, hop_pte_addr); in device_va_to_pa()
656 hop_pte_addr = get_hop2_pte_addr(ctx, mmu_prop, hop_addr, virt_addr); in device_va_to_pa()
657 hop_pte = hdev->asic_funcs->read_pte(hdev, hop_pte_addr); in device_va_to_pa()
663 hop_pte_addr = get_hop3_pte_addr(ctx, mmu_prop, hop_addr, virt_addr); in device_va_to_pa()
664 hop_pte = hdev->asic_funcs->read_pte(hdev, hop_pte_addr); in device_va_to_pa()
671 hop_pte_addr in device_va_to_pa()
[all...]
/kernel/linux/linux-6.6/drivers/accel/habanalabs/common/
H A Ddebugfs.c470 i, hops_info.hop_info[i].hop_pte_addr); in mmu_show()
H A Dhabanalabs.h2765 * @hop_pte_addr: The address of the hop entry.
2770 u64 hop_pte_addr; member

Completed in 14 milliseconds